Kreitzer Name Meaning

German and Jewish (Ashkenazic): variant of Kreutzer . Compare Critzer Crytser and Crytzer . In some cases also a Germanized form of Slovenian Krajcar or Krajcer: nickname from krajcar ‘kreutzer’ (the name of an Austrian copper coin; see Kreutzer ).

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022

Where is the Kreitzer family from?

You can see how Kreitzer families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Kreitzer family name was found in the USA, the UK, and Canada between 1840 and 1920. The most Kreitzer families were found in USA in 1880. In 1911 there were 4 Kreitzer families living in Ontario. This was 100% of all the recorded Kreitzer's in Canada. Ontario had the highest population of Kreitzer families in 1911.
